About the open role:
Proactively monitor, maintain, and troubleshoot network systems to ensure seamless service delivery, while optimizing the availability, performance, and security of the IT infrastructure.
What you’ll do:
Continuously track system performance with various monitoring tools;
Perform Level 1 investigations, resolve alerts, and escalate critical issues as needed;
Analyze outages, implement fixes, and log incidents in the ticketing system;
Collaborate with IT teams, vendors, and customers to resolve complex issues;
Assist in refining and improving alert descriptions
Participate in on-call rotations for after-hours support;
Develop dashboards, lead post-incident reviews, and refine alerts.
What we expect from you:
Basic IT knowledge;
Degree in IT or a related field or 1 year of hands-on experience in a similar position;
Ability to work in 12-hour day/night shifts;
Detail-oriented with strong analytical skills.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ene
Key Facts About NYC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
-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
